Clinic Operations Executive

International Cancer Specialists Pte. Ltd.

International Cancer Specialists Pte. Ltd. company logo

International Cancer Specialists, Singapore's only family-owned Medical Oncology & Haematology practice, is looking for talent who desire to make a remarkable difference in the lives of cancer patients and their loved ones, from Singapore and beyond.


You can expect to play a key role in the first-line care of everyone who needs us, whether they may be a cancer patient undergoing treatment for the first time, or someone from overseas who needs an urgent second opinion, your work will impact their lives in a meaningful manner.


In addition, you can expect to manage critical operational matters like the efficient submission of medical claims to relieve the financial burdens of cancer patients, as well as ensuring the smooth operations of our cancer centre, together with our clinical and administrative team.


Experience in the healthcare industry is not necessary, but a positive learning attitude with a desire to learn and help others is! We welcome applicants from all walks of life and career stages, and offer comprehensive training and mentoring, in an encouraging environment.


Successful candidates can also expect regular training and development opportunities sponsored by us, as well as career progression in a variety of pathways, as we are a dynamic organization growing in 3 countries in the region.



1. Clinic Assistant Objectives:


· Manage all general administrative duties and assist in the daily operations of the clinic(s) including patient escort, collection and/or delivery of medical reports, scheduling appointments for patients

· Respond to all email inquiries and incoming calls in a customer-centric manner

· Help with regular stock takes

· Ensure the accuracy and timeliness of each patient bill, check that there is no outstanding payment owed by each patient, prompt submission of claims etc. This includes tracking and collation of amount receivable from patients, hospitals, and insurances etc.

· Manage the daily submission of claims to the relevant claims portal. This includes Third Party Administrator Portal, Insurance Provider Portal, Mediclaim Portal etc.

· Manage end-of-day submission of payment invoices report. To work closely with Finance to ensure that all payments are accounted for. This includes patient refund (if any), rectification of any submission error etc.

· Manage administrative matters such as ordering of weekly lunch, maintaining office supplies, collecting letters from the letter box, providing resource support for organising events, arrangement and coordinating equipment delivery, and maintenance etc.

· Responsible for purchasing (including services) as assigned such as making and collecting of name cards, scheduled carpet cleaning etc.

· Ensure that the clinic(s) are always clean and orderly.

· Other administrative duties as assigned.


2. Requirements:


· Possess a Diploma or equivalent.

· At least 3 years of working experience, preferably in a customer-facing environment

· Have an eye for detail

· Proficient in MS Office or generally comfortable working with computers

· Good and responsible team player

· Able to work alternate 5.5 days work week
